one way that you could use your first kit is to cut about 2 feet or so from your main line and cut this piece into 3 or 4 equal lengths. Tie a swivel and a hook onto each length. Tie one end of the main line to a sharp stick and thread the swivels onto the main line. Using your shot as stoppers position the hook lengths about 2 feet apart (depending on the width of the water), then tie the free end of the line to another sharp stick. Bait your hooks with artificial or local bait, Wade into the water if safe to do so and push the first sharp stick into the bed. Pay out your line and secure the other stick into the bank or secure with a rock, tree root etc. Leave this line out for a few hours, keep an eye on the line every now and again for security sakes. Then hopefully pull in your line full of nice plump fish for breakfast.
